This is my understanding of how you can take advantage of the good deals on Amazon, and still port your number from Verizon to Cingular.
First, go ahead and purchase the phone and plan via Amazon. Then, after you have decided that the Cingular plan is worth keeping, go into a Cingular store, or call Customer Service. Your Verizon account will still need to be active at this time. You should be able to have your existing Verizon number ported to your new Cingular account. As long as your existing Verizon account has not been de-activated, you should be able to port your number at any time...

1) Cingular customer service: Yes, you can port the number, but you will be charged $30 "number change" fee if your phone originally came activated with a different number (huh? say what?).
2) Cingular telesales: Yes, you can port your number from your previous provider at any time by going to a store, and there is no charge (ok, sounds good, but see #3 below).
3) Cingular store: No, you cannot port your number if your phone was activated via a third-party reseller. ...
